Metallic Jacketed Vessels : A Detailed Guide

These heavy-duty stainless steel jacketed tanks are widely utilized across various industries for maintaining temperature. The jacket – typically constructed from superior stainless steel – allows for the flow of a cooling medium, enabling precise control of the contained process heat . They offer superior protection against corrosion and sanitary properties, making them perfect for food processing and other critical environments.

Picking the Correct Metallic Jacketed Tank for Your Operation

Selecting a suitable stainless steel jacketed tank is vital for ensuring optimal performance in your manufacturing system. Consider closely factors such as necessary size, operating temperature, stress, and kind of fluid being handled. Different varieties of stainless steel, like 304 or 316, present varying degrees of rust protection, impacting durability and complete cost. Furthermore, the outer shell, including channel measurement and configuration, directly affects temperature uniformity and energy effectiveness.

Stainless Jacketed Container Deployment: Industries and Functions

Stainless SS jacketed tanks find widespread uses across a varied range of industries . In the food processing sector, they're vital for brewing of alcohol , dairy products , and various other foods . The medicine industry counts on them for containing fragile ingredients and processing aseptic liquids . Chemical producers use these containers for chemical procedures , blending substances, and holding of hazardous materials . H2O purification plants also employ jacketed tanks for storing and treating aqueous supplies . Beyond these, they function in heating arrangements and several other manufacturing settings .

Stainless Jacketed Vessel Cost, Stock & Fabrication

The overall expense stainless steel jacketed tank of a steel jacketed vessel is influenced by several factors . Material option plays a crucial role; typically, grades like 304 or 316 alloy are used, with 316 supplying better corrosion resistance but at a higher cost . Fabrication techniques also impact expenses ; assembling, shaping , and polishing all contribute. Tank size is another primary element, with larger capacities generally needing more components and work . Customization , such as specific design or supplemental functionalities , will further boost the cost . Typical fabrication processes involve plate bending, building, and accurate joining .
